Searched refs:widen (Results 1 - 6 of 6) sorted by relevance

/xsrc/external/mit/MesaLib/dist/src/panfrost/bifrost/valhall/
H A Dvalhall.py101 def __init__(self, index, size, is_float = False, swizzle = False, widen = False, lanes = False, lane = None, absneg = False, notted = False, name = ""):
107 self.widen = widen
122 if widen or lanes:
123 self.offset['widen'] = 26 if index == 1 else 36
124 self.bits['widen'] = 4 # XXX: too much?
149 self.widen = False
186 if len(srcs) == 3 and (srcs[1].widen or srcs[1].lanes):
213 widen = el.get('widen', Fals
[all...]
H A Dasm.py254 elif mod in enums[f'swizzles_{src.size}_bit'].bare_values and (src.widen or src.lanes):
258 encoded |= (val << src.offset['widen'])
264 elif src.size == 32 and mod in enums['widen'].bare_values:
268 val = enums['widen'].bare_values.index(mod)
290 elif src.widen and not swizzled and src.size == 16:
294 encoded |= (val << src.offset['widen'])
/xsrc/external/mit/libxcb/dist/src/
H A Dxcb_in.c533 static uint64_t widen(xcb_connection_t *c, unsigned int request) function in typeref:typename:uint64_t
552 ret = wait_for_reply(c, widen(c, request), e);
639 discard_reply(c, widen(c, sequence));
669 ret = poll_for_reply(c, widen(c, request), reply, error);
671 ret = poll_for_reply(c, widen(c, request), reply, error);
744 request = widen(c, cookie.sequence);
/xsrc/external/mit/libX11/dist/src/
H A Dxcb_io.c218 static void widen(uint64_t *wide, unsigned int narrow) function in typeref:typename:void
271 widen(&event_sequence, event->full_sequence);
757 widen(&event_sequence, event->full_sequence);
/xsrc/external/mit/MesaLib/src/panfrost/bifrost/
H A Dbi_printer.c602 bi_widen_as_str(enum bi_widen widen) argument
604 switch (widen) {
614 unreachable("Invalid widen");
/xsrc/external/mit/MesaLib/dist/docs/relnotes/
H A D21.2.0.rst938 - pan/bi: Workaround widen restrictions on +FADD.f32
4453 - aco: don't ever widen 8/16-bit sgpr load_shared

Completed in 13 milliseconds